Summary

Presents advanced techniques to release negative energy from the body and reestablish a healthy flow of vital energy to internal tissues and organs. Includes techniques for detoxifying and rejuvenating the body. Works with the navel center, where negative energy accumulates.

Author Biography

Mantak Chia, world famous Inner Alchemy and Qi Gong master, founded the Universal Healing Tao System in 1979. He has taught and certified tens of thousands of students and instructors from all over the world. He is the director of the Tao Garden Integrative Medicine Health Spa and Resort training center in northern Thailand and the author of 33 books, including Chi Nei Tsang, Chi Self-Massage, and the bestselling The Multi-Orgasmic Man.
